    Quote Originally Posted by BobH View Post
    Good looking handle and it appears well made. The diamond cut checkering I might like better if it had points to the diamonds instead of being flat. Only way to tell though would be to try the it.
    They said that they did that on purpose. When it is flat, it less spiky and more comfortable on your fingers and still have an excellent grip. I can confirm that. Really comfortable.

    Plus the "typical" tool for creating diamond knurling like that may be a PITA to do on TI with consistent results. Probably because it pushes the material in instead of cutting it away, which is more of what looks like was done here. Geezer would know better tho. All-in-all some impressive machining
